The Iowa High School marching band competition season has ended, and area schools celebrated another special fall of performances across central Iowa.

For the 46th consecutive season, the Pella Marching Dutch earned a Division I “Superior” score at the Iowa High School Music Association state festival, one of the longest ongoing streaks in Iowa. In the evening, Pella claimed 1st place in Class 3A and overall at the Mid Iowa Band Championships in Ankeny. This fall, the Marching Dutch outscored every Iowa school they competed against head-to-head.

The Pride of Indianola Marching Band earned a Division I score at state and place 7th out of 12 in class 4A at Waukee in the evening.
